A.No operator of a motor vehicle shall allow a passenger to ride outside the passenger compartment of the vehicle on the streets, highways or turnpikes of this state; provided, this section shall not apply to persons so riding on private property or for parades or special events nor shall this section apply to passengers riding on the bed of a pickup truck.
B.Any person convicted of violating the provisions of subsection A of this section shall be punished by a fine of Ten Dollars ($10.00) and shall pay court costs of Fifteen Dollars ($15.00), provided the Department of Public Safety shall not assess points to the driving record of any licensed or unlicensed person convicted of a violation of this section.

Legislative History

Added by Laws 1991, c. 309, § 7, eff. July 1, 1991.
